apparent with a physiological level of glucocorticoids of about 0.3 @tMin humans, as shown in experiments on hepatoma cells (4) and L5i 78Y cells(6)in vitro,Factor1 maypossiblyenhance the effect of physiological levels of glucocorticoid in vivo and thus may itself have the therapeutic effects of glucocorticoid. In this work, we examine (a) the effect of Factor 1 on the growth inhibition by glucocorticoid of the solid form of L51 78Y cells and the ascitic form of Li 210 mouse lymphoblasts in vivo and (b) whether Facton i itself enhances the effect of physio logical levels of glucocorticoid sufficiently to inhibit growth of these lymphoblasts in vivo in order to investigate the clinical use of Factor 1 instead of glucocorticoid.

Amplification of growth inhibition by glucocorticoid on L5178Y and L1210 lymphoblasts in vivo.
One component of a factor in Proteus mirabilis (Factor 1) which specifically amplifies the induction of several liver enzymes by glucocorticoid in target cells also increases the growth inhibition of glucocorticoid on the ascitic form of L1210 cells and solid tumors of L5178Y lymphoblasts in vivo. متن کاملThe requirement for L-asparagine of mouse leukemia cells L5178Y in culture.
L-Asparagine is responsible for a major portion of the effect of peptone on the growth of L5178Y lymphoblasts in culture and is essential for the reproduction of these cells. متن کاملThe Effects of Phenylalanine Ammonia-Lyase on Leukemic Lymphocytes in Vitrol
Phenylalanine ammonia-lyase, which irreversibly deaminates phenylalanine and tyrosine, markedly inhibited the growth of human leukemic and murine L5178Y lymphoblasts in vitro but had a negligible effect on resting (nondividing) normal lymphocytes.
